TRS Staffing have a fantastic opportunity for an Inter Array Cable (IAC) Client Representative.

The role will see you be present onboard the Contractor’s CLV and observe their activities associated with load-out, transportation and installation of the Array Cables and CPS providing feedback to the onshore teams.

Experience        
  • Experience (minimum of 5-years) providing similar services in offshore renewables (preferably under an EPCI Contract environment);
  • A strong working knowledge and understanding of the appointed rolls under CDM (2015) and UK Health and Safety requirements.
  • An excellent understanding of cable installation practices including but not limited to monopile aperture & J-Tube pull-ins, quadrant use for 2nd ends, marine management, and inspection experience.
  • Working knowledge of offshore construction contracts [EPCI preferable] with a good understanding of the contractual implications of breakdown, weather downtime, etc….
  • Proven experience in cable installation on UK windfarms is essential.
  • Experience in quality assurance activities and interface with Marine Warranty Surveyors.
  • An ability to read and understand technical documents and observe operations to ensure that the Contractor is working to their accepted documentation.
  • Previous experience in and the ability to understand consenting conditions such that the Employers requirement can be monitored whilst offshore.
  • Conversant with international codes, procedures, and specifications relevant to offshore construction activities.
Previous experience of:
  • Work preparation and sequence planning
  • Simultaneous Operations assessment
  • Health and safety oversight
  • Quality management
  • Environmental management
  • Excellent communication skills, able to communicate effectively with others (shall be fluent in spoken and written English)
Experience in the following desirable but not essential:
  • Experience in Wind Turbine Generator installation and familiarity with associated installation systems and tools.
  • Experience in Termination of High Voltage cables, specifically Pfisterer types.
  • Experience of working with electrical safety rules, permitting and safe systems of work.

Qualifications (Mandatory)     
GWO Training:
  • Sea Survival,
  • Working at heights,
  • First Aid,
  • Fire Awareness,
  • Manual Handling.
  • Helicopter Under Water Escape Training (HUET)
  • XBR” Shoulder measurement
  • Compressed Air Emergency Breathing System (CA-EBS) certification.
  • Current valid medical certificate for offshore work. The accepted medicals as defined in the CPP is Oil and Gas UK (OGUK). Please note that OGUK must be accompanied by an additional fitness assessment such as the "Chester Step Test" or equivalent.
  • IOSH Managing Safely or similar HSE training.
  • Evidence of CDM competency
  • IT proficient (Microsoft Word, Excel, and Internet), experience using inspection/auditing software in a construction environment desirable
